Data=dlmread('GM4.txt');
Class1=Data(Data(:,end)==1,:);
Class2=Data(Data(:,end)==2,:);

[V,D]=NDET_mex(Data);
[D,ind]=sort(diag(D),'descend');
V=V(:,ind);
New_Data=Data(:,1:end-1)*V;

plot(Class1(:,1),Class1(:,2),'*','MarkerSize',20,'Color',[0 0.4 0]);
hold all;
plot(Class2(:,1),Class2(:,2),'o','MarkerSize',20,'Color',[0 0 0.5]);
hold all;

MIN=-6;
MAX=6;
MEAN=mean(Data);

plot([MIN*V(1,1)+MEAN(1),MAX*V(1,1)+MEAN(1)],[MIN*V(2,1)+MEAN(2),MAX*V(2,1)+MEAN(2)],'-','LineWidth',25,'Color',[0.501 0 0]);
hold all;
plot([MIN*V(1,2)+MEAN(1),MAX*V(1,2)+MEAN(1)],[MIN*V(2,2)+MEAN(2),MAX*V(2,2)+MEAN(2)],'-','LineWidth',10,'Color',[0.501 0 0]);
hold all;